Leo Sayer is a renowned British singer-songwriter who has made a significant impact in the music industry. One of his most notable achievements came in 1977 when he won a Grammy for Best Rhythm & Blues Song. The song that earned him this prestigious accolade was "You Make Me Feel Like Dancing."

"You Make Me Feel Like Dancing" is a catchy and upbeat track that perfectly embodies Sayer's unique musical style. Released as a single in 1976, it quickly climbed the charts and became a massive hit, both in the United States and internationally. The song's infectious disco sound, combined with Sayer's soulful vocals, resonated with audiences across different genres.

Winning the Grammy for Best Rhythm & Blues Song in 1977 solidified Sayer's talent and established him as a force to be reckoned with in the music industry. The award recognized the song's remarkable rhythm and blues elements, which were masterfully crafted by Sayer and his team.

Leo Sayer's success with "You Make Me Feel Like Dancing" extended beyond the Grammy award. The song also received widespread critical acclaim and commercial success, reaching the top of the charts in multiple countries. Its popularity has endured over the years, and it continues to be a beloved part of Sayer's discography.

In addition to his Grammy win, Leo Sayer has had numerous other accomplishments throughout his career. With a distinctive voice and a knack for crafting memorable songs, Sayer has amassed a dedicated fanbase and left a lasting impact on the music industry.

Overall, "You Make Me Feel Like Dancing" remains a standout track in Leo Sayer's impressive repertoire, and its Grammy win for Best Rhythm & Blues Song in 1977 serves as a testament to the song's timeless appeal.
